Checksum: getValue()
<source lang="java">
import java.io.FileInputStream; import java.io.IOException; import java.io.InputStream; import java.util.zip.CRC32; import java.util.zip.Checksum; public class Main {
public static void main(String[] args) throws IOException { FileInputStream fin = new FileInputStream(args[0]); System.out.println(args[0] + ":\t" + getCRC32(fin)); fin.close(); } public static long getCRC32(InputStream in) throws IOException { Checksum cs = new CRC32(); for (int b = in.read(); b != -1; b = in.read()) { cs.update(b); } return cs.getValue(); }
}
</source>
Checksum: reset()
<source lang="java">
import java.util.zip.CRC32; import java.util.zip.Checksum; public class Main {
public static void main(String[] argv) throws Exception { byte[] bytes = "some data".getBytes(); // Compute Adler-32 checksum Checksum checksumEngine = new CRC32(); checksumEngine.update(bytes, 0, bytes.length); long checksum = checksumEngine.getValue(); checksumEngine.reset(); }
}
</source>

implements Checksum
<source lang="java">
import java.util.zip.Checksum; public class ParityChecksum implements Checksum {
long checksum = 0; public void update(int b) { int numOneBits = 0; for (int i = 1; i < 256; i *= 2) { if ((b & i) != 0) numOneBits++; } checksum = (checksum + numOneBits) % 2; } public void update(byte data[], int offset, int length) { for (int i = offset; i < offset + length; i++) { this.update(data[i]); } } public long getValue() { return checksum; } public void reset() { checksum = 0; }
}
</source>
